#4deed8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4deed8 is composed of 30.2% red, 93.3% green and 84.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 9.2%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 171.8 degrees, a saturation of 82.6% and a lightness of 61.8%. #4deed8 color hex could be obtained by blending #9affff with #00ddb1.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

#4deed8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4deed8 has RGB values of R:77, G:238, B:216 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0, Y:0.09,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 5107416.
